About Us

Internews Pakistan is an Islamabad-based independent news agency, primarily focusing on print and electronic media with its services in text, photo, and video in digital multimedia form. Internews Pakistan, a project of Lord Media Services, offers daily news services, including current affairs news, features, articles, and analyses of current value in Urdu and English. Internews Pakistan has reporters across the country as well as in Azad Kashmir with bureaus in Karachi and Lahore. Internews Pakistan also provides news services by translating foreign English news material into Urdu. Internews Pakistan has been providing news and content services to over 500 organizations, including newspapers, radio stations, TV channels and websites, inside and outside Pakistan.
